Output 828e21757159315bbb56f2d5eae6edb4cd10e947a784578b39721a43d93bf460:2

value
137238600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53a68ce33b93b1dcd25c2a71c2b2b96a46943312 OP_EQUAL
address
39KKXaxgWdjQ8ELpNoK2vtm6PcDEt1fKZ6
transaction
828e21757159315bbb56f2d5eae6edb4cd10e947a784578b39721a43d93bf460
spent
true